The practice of Tai Chi appears to be physical on first observation, but its power comes from the mental (internal) aspects. Taoist philosophy teaches the mental disciplines and one must understand Taoism to gain the full potential. The Tao Te Ching is an ancient Chinese book, around 2500 years old. Taoist philosophy is embedded in the poems of this book, allegedly written by Lao Tse. Scholars still debate who the actual author is, and you can find many translations of the original. The age of the language used in the original manuscript makes some words difficult, if not impossible to translate. The book contains 81 poems on Tao, which translates to mean

The Way

The Tao that can be followed is not the eternal Tao. 
The name that can be named is not the eternal name. 
The nameless is the origin of heaven and earth 
While naming is the origin of the myriad things. 
Therefore, always desireless, you see the mystery 
Ever desiring, you see the manifestations. 
These two are the same-- 
When they appear they are named differently.

Their sameness is the mystery, 
Mystery within mystery;

The door to all marvels.
